Anti-fouling Silicone Urinary Catheter for Adults Needing Long-term Catheterisation: a Pilot and Feasibility Study
Sponsor: National Cheng-Kung University Hospital
Summary
This single-centre randomised pilot and feasibility study assessed whether an anti-fouling zwitterionic silicone urinary catheter can be deployed and evaluated in frail, elderly adults who require long-term indwelling catheterisation. In the experimental catheter, a zwitterionic polymer is blended into the silicone matrix rather than applied as a surface coating. Forty participants were randomly allocated to the anti-fouling catheter or a conventional commercial silicone catheter, with monthly catheter changes for up to eight cycles. The primary aim was to establish feasibility and acceptability (recruitment, retention, specimen completeness, safety and patient/family acceptability) and to obtain exploratory effect-size estimates (catheter-associated urinary tract infection, catheter-removal pain, urinalysis and urine culture) to inform the design of a future confirmatory trial. The study was not powered to test efficacy.
Official title: Feasibility and Acceptability of an Anti-fouling Silicone Urinary Catheter for Long-term Catheterisation: a Single-centre, Single-blind Randomised Pilot and Feasibility Study

Interventions
Anti-fouling zwitterionic silicone urinary catheter
Zwitterionic polymer bulk-blended into the medical-grade silicone matrix (not a surface coating); ethylene-oxide sterilised; changed monthly.
Conventional silicone urinary catheter
Conventional commercial silicone Foley catheter, identical French size; changed monthly.
